Abstract

Objective: To determine the diagnostic accuracy of contrast enhanced computed tomography (CECT) of neck in detecting the neoplastic invasion of the laryngeal cartilages among patients with clinically suspected laryngeal carcinoma taking histopathology as gold standard.

Methodology: This cross-sectional study was department of Radiology, Civil Hospital, Karachi from April to October 2018, on the 141 clinically suspected of laryngeal cancer patients of either age and gender. CECT of neck was performed in supine position and parameters were analyzed. Subsequently the patient who were referred to biopsy and histopathological results were followed and recorded and diagnostic accuracy of contrast enhanced CT was analyzed taking histopathology as gold standard.

Results: There were 67.4% male and 32.6% female patients. Mean age was 56.85±9.57 years. Mean symptoms duration was 7.84±2.30 weeks. Out of all, 58.2% cases were diagnosed with laryngeal cartilage invasion in laryngeal carcinoma by CT scan and 60.3% cases by histopathology. Sensitivity, Specificity, PPV, NPV and accuracy were 90.2%, 81.4%, 87.1%, 85.7%, and 86.5% respectively.

Conclusion: Computed Tomography is a precise and non-invasive imaging method for the staging of laryngeal with high sensitivity, although has relatively less specificity.
